Patent number: 9303981Abstract: A position-measuring device includes a scale and a scanning unit movable relative thereto. The scale has a measuring graduation, a reference mark and area markings located on a first and on a second side of the reference mark which are configured to exert different deflection effects on a scanning beam incident thereon. An area signal detector is configured to detect, during optical scanning of the area markings, a fringe pattern in a detection plane of the area signal detector. A periodic screen grating is disposed between the scale and the area signal detector and is configured to produce the fringe pattern in the detection plane of the area signal detector such that at least two distinguishable scanning signals are generatable from the fringe pattern as a function of a position of the scanning unit relative to the reference mark.Type: GrantFiled: November 21, 2014Date of Patent: April 5, 2016Assignee: DR. JOHANNES HEIDENHAIN GMBHInventors: Juergen Schoser, Wolfgang Holzapfel, Michael Hermann, Volker Hoefer

Patent number: 8495820Abstract: An angle-measuring device including a first component group and a second component group, the component groups being disposed in a manner allowing rotation relative to each other by a bearing. The first component group includes a housing having a connecting device, as well as a scanning unit. The second component group includes a shaft to which a code disk is attached, and a flow channel having a directional component parallel to the axis. The angle-measuring device is configured such that a negative pressure is able to be applied to the connecting device, so that a fluid surrounding the angle-measuring device with a pressure flows through the angle-measuring device to remove contaminants by suction. At the applied negative pressure, a first mass flow of the fluid which flows through the flow channel is greater than a second mass flow which flows through the bearing gap.Type: GrantFiled: July 14, 2009Date of Patent: July 30, 2013Assignee: Dr. Johannes Heidenhain GmbHInventors: Zlatko Maric, Volker Hoefer

Patent number: 7760471Abstract: A positioning device includes a housing and a shaft that is able to be swiveled about a centrical position relative to the housing, at whose one end an element that is to be positioned is attachable. Furthermore, the positioning device has a swivel drive and a position measuring device. A cable, for the electrical connection of swivelable parts in the positioning device to a stationary unit, has a spiral-shaped course leading radially outwardly, starting from the shaft that is located in the centrical position.Type: GrantFiled: October 13, 2006Date of Patent: July 20, 2010Assignee: Dr. Johannes Heidenhain GmbHInventors: Volker Hoefer, Gerhard Scheglmann

Patent number: 7507949Abstract: A positioning device includes a housing and a shaft that is able to swivel relative to the housing and at one end of which an element to be positioned is attachable. The positioning device further includes a roller-bearing unit for supporting the shaft with respect to the housing, a swivel drive and a position-measuring device. The shaft is arranged in a manner that it is torsionally stiff, but axially movable relative to the housing via a ring diaphragm secured to the roller-bearing unit and to the housing.Type: GrantFiled: September 21, 2006Date of Patent: March 24, 2009Assignee: Dr. Johannes Heidenhain GmbHInventors: Gerhard Scheglmann, Volker Hoefer

Patent number: 7474511Abstract: A voice-coil motor includes a stator and a rotor, which is pivoted about a swivel axis, with respect to the stator. The rotor and/or the stator has a printed circuit board that includes at least one circuit-board conductor, and the at least one circuit-board conductor is arranged such that it forms at least one coil unit in a plane, the at least one coil unit including several circuit traces. Within one coil unit, more than two circuit traces have a section, in which the specific circuit trace is oriented in the direction of the swivel axis.Type: GrantFiled: June 24, 2005Date of Patent: January 6, 2009Assignee: Dr. Johannes Heidenhain GmbHInventors: Gerhard Scheglmann, Volker Hoefer

Patent number: 7159781Abstract: A scanning unit for a position measuring device for scanning a measuring graduation thereof, includes a scanning structure provided on a carrier and formed such that, by interaction of electromagnetic radiation, with the measuring graduation and the scanning structure, a periodic stripe pattern is generated. A detector arrangement includes detector elements of different phases that generate output signals having a phase shift. The detector elements form a periodic pattern, and each detector element is assigned exactly one region of the scanning structure referred to as a bar. The detector elements are combined to form two detector groups. Detector elements of the same phase belong to the same detector group, and the detector elements within one detector group are interconnected. The bars of each detector group cover an active area of equal size. The area center of gravity of the area covered by the bars of the detector groups coincide.Type: GrantFiled: February 16, 2006Date of Patent: January 9, 2007Assignee: Dr. Johannes Heidenhain GmbHInventors: Walter Huber, Volker Hoefer

Patent number: 7136249Abstract: A positioning device includes a swiveling shaft, at one end of which an element to be positioned may be attached, a swivel drive, made up of a rotor, which is movable relative to a stator, a position measuring device, made up of two parts movable relative to each other, and a roller bearing, which includes several rolling elements. The rotor of the swivel drive and a first part of the position measuring device are connected to the shaft in a rotatably fixed manner. The rolling elements are made of a ceramic material.Type: GrantFiled: October 20, 2004Date of Patent: November 14, 2006Assignee: Dr. Johannes Heidenhain GmbHInventors: Volker Hoefer, Johann Lahr, Johann Mitterreiter, Gerhard Scheglmann
